It's important to mention that through the discomfort of loss and grief, sorrow is a natural response to loss.

Managing the loss of your grandmother can stimulate a series of intense reactions, ideas and feelings - from extreme unhappiness to anger, frustrating sensations of regret to profound emptiness.

Bereavement is not restricted to a psychological reaction alone. Grieving the loss of your grandmother can also stimulate a physical action, consisting of modifications in weight or cravings, problems sleeping, muscle pains, and impaired immune responses, which can affect our health in substantial ways. This is where grief counselling in Pembroke after the loss of your grandmother can help.

The expression of our emotions or behaviours often represents the stage of sorrow and loss we are in. In no specific order, when we experience grief, the stages of sorrow consist of:

  • Denial: functioning as a defense mechanism to safeguard us against frustrating emotions, denial involves the refusal to accept the truth (or intensity) of the loss
  • Anger: once the disastrous reality of the loss sets in, anger often becomes the primary defence, which might be directed inwardly toward ourselves, towards others, and even to your grandmother
  • Bargaining: there might come a time when we try to work out or negotiate with a higher power or ourselves as a method to go back in time, reverse the disaster, or lessen the destruction we are experiencing
  • Depression: feelings of intense sadness, isolation, and anguish prevail in the experience of sorrow, triggering people to withdraw from others and battle with feelings of despondence
  • Acceptance: it requires time, but the truth of our loss can end up being simpler to grapple with, permitting us to get used to a new normal without our grandmother in the physical world

Moving through the stages of each type of grief experience often takes place in a non-linear method. It's also possible to avoid phases, move back and forth between phases, and even reach acceptance but still permit signs of sorrow, anger, or anxiety to set in down the road.

Given that every journey is unique, we provide a variety of evidence-based strategies proven to help individuals deal with grief with more clarity. Here are a few of our typically used interventions.

Cognitive Behavioural Therapy

Often, our counsellors use Cognitive Behaviour Therapy (CBT), which helps people who are coping with sorrow, as it focuses on identifying and challenging unfavourable idea patterns or behaviours that accompany sensations of grief.

From a trauma-informed lens, CBT counselling can assist people recognize and customize certain negative ideas, such as guilt or self-blame, in an effort to establish much healthier coping techniques. This approach is important for constructing durability and enabling the progressive change to life without your grandmother.

Acceptance and Commitment Therapy

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) is another valuable method that focuses on accepting challenging emotions related to sorrow. Instead of forcing ourselves to eliminate or reduce these feelings, ACT motivates us to mindfully engage with them within a safe and nonjudgmental healing environment. It guides us to live authentically and make choices that align with our values.

Oftentimes, our counsellors make use of ACT to promote mental flexibility, positioning us in the driver's seat of our discomfort and permitting us to adjust to the changes of our loss while likewise discovering function and fulfillment in life.

Emotion-Focused Therapy

As we understand, emotions are at the leading edge of our grieving process. They exist whether we try to express, transform, or reduce them. Emotion-Focused Therapy (EFT) focuses on assisting us end up being more knowledgeable about our feelings, discover how to express them safely, and transform particular maladaptive or troublesome emotional reactions into much healthier ones.

Our trauma-informed counsellors make use of EFT as the framework for exploring and making sense of the emotional impact of our grief. Working together, we can develop psychological regulation abilities essential for coping and healing.

Narrative Therapy

During grief counselling in Pembroke after the loss of your grandmother, narrative therapy concentrates on the stories we tell about our experiences. It helps us process sorrow and work through the pain by externalizing it. In other words, narrative therapy enables us to view our sorrow as a different entity rather than a part of our identity.

Our counsellors make use of narrative therapy to help us rebuild or reinterpret our grief stories, emphasizing our own strengths, durability, and agency. This method can provide us a way to discover meaning, produce a more empowered narrative of our stories, and offer a path toward healing.
